TiGenix in advanced talks over Dutch facility, drug partnering

Belgian biotech company TiGenix said on Tuesday it was in advanced discussions to sell its Dutch manufacturing facility and separately to find a partner for its candidate treatment for a disorder linked to Crohn's disease. TiGenix said the renewal by Dutch authorities of its license for the plant in Sittard-Geleen had allowed it to move ahead with talks on selling the facility while continuing to make its drugs there. TiGenix is enrolling patients for Phase III trials for Cx601 for the treatment of complex perianal fistulas, abnormal channels that can develop between the end of the bowel and the skin, in patients of bowel disorder Crohn's disease.
